The Defense Logistics Agency is soliciting 190 set screws with National Stock Number 5305-01-631-0003 under solicitation SPE4A6-26-T-09QY, with a response deadline of August 3, 2026. The contract requires delivery to Hill AFB, Utah, under FOB Origin terms, with a performance period of 96 days after award, targeting a need ship date of November 8, 2026. All items must comply with stringent packaging and marking standards including ASTM D3951, MIL-STD-129, and DLA-specific RP001, with direct item marking per RQ017 and barcoding containing NSN, CAGE code, and lot information. Hazardous materials must adhere to 29 CFR 1910.1200 labeling requirements, and radioactive materials require prior written notification. The contractor must implement a quality system compliant with SAE AS9003 or ISO 9001 and maintain zero non-conformances during inspection, which occurs at the destination under government oversight using AQLs of 0.1 for critical, 1.0 for major, and 4.0 for minor defects. The contract incorporates numerous Federal Acquisition Regulation and Defense Federal Acquisition Regulation Supplement clauses governing compliance with employment, cybersecurity, environmental, and procurement standards. Key clauses include the Equal Opportunity for Workers with Disabilities, Combating Trafficking in Persons, Employment Eligibility Verification, Sustainable Products, NIST SP 800-171 DOD Assessment, Safeguarding Covered Defense Information, and prohibitions on hexavalent chromium, toxic material disposal, and procurement from communist Chinese military companies. Payment must be submitted electronically via Wide Area WorkFlow, with cost vouchers and receiving reports required based on line item type. Offerors must provide a Unique Entity Identifier and complete socioeconomic representations, including small business, WOSB, SDVOSB, or HUBZone status, with joint ventures required to disclose all partner UEIs. No pricing details are provided in the solicitation, and the contract type remains unspecified. All submissions must be made through DIBBS by the deadline, and no formal attachments or proposal format requirements are stipulated beyond regulatory compliance.

The Defense Logistics Agency, through DLA Land and Maritime, has issued Request for Quotations SPE7L7-26-Q-2412 for the procurement of 100 nickel-cadmium wet storage batteries (NSN 6140-01-241-2296). These batteries are specified as wet, discharged, and spillable, with a non-extendable shelf life of 36 months. Approved sources include Aerodesign, Inc. (P/N AD-31004-04C) and Marathonnorco Aerospace, Inc. (P/N 31004-04C). The items are to be delivered to the Royal Saudi Air Force within 60 days after the order date. This is a fixed-price solicitation where award will be based on the best value to the government, evaluating technical conformity, past performance, and offered delivery time. Because the batteries are classified as corrosive materials (UN2795), the contractor must strictly adhere to hazardous materials regulations, including ICAO, IMDG, 49 CFR, and AFJMAN 24-204. Packaging must comply with MIL-STD-2073-1E Level B, Pack Code Q, using 4G fiber-board boxes. Inspection will be conducted by DCMA at the distributor or OEM site, with acceptance occurring at the origin. Administrative requirements include the use of the Wide Area WorkFlow system for electronic invoicing and receiving reports. The contract incorporates various FAR and DFARS clauses, including the Buy American and Balance of Payments Program and strict cybersecurity reporting requirements under DFARS 252.204-7012. Quotes must be submitted electronically by the deadline of September 17, 2026.
